Contract Award - London Fire Brigade Fleet Management

 

The London Fire and Emergency Planning Authority (LFEPA) has today named Babcock as the preferred bidder on a 21 year contract to manage London Fire Brigade's (LFB) vehicle fleet. This follows the successful delivery of an interim fleet management contract awarded to Babcock by LFEPA in November 2012.

 

Following the LFEPA announcement, there will be a mandatory 10 day standstill period before final contract award. The contract is expected to become operational on13 November 2014.

 

Over the 21 year contract period, Babcock will be working with LFB, the UK's largest fire and rescue service, to manage and improve availability of its fleet of 500 vehicles and 50,000 pieces of specialist equipment across Greater London.

 

As part of Babcock's commitment to LFB, investment will be made in operational premises at an existing site in Ruislip and at a new facility in Greenwich. This will provide state-of-the-art facilities for the management and maintenance of the fleet as well as enabling greater community engagement.

 

This new contract will build on Babcock's long-term partnership with LFB. Since 2011 Babcock has been developing and delivering enhanced training programmes and new world-class training facilities to LFB as part of a 25 year contract.

Babcock is the UK's leading engineering support services company with revenue of over £3.2 billion in 2013 and an order book of around £11.5 billion. We are trusted to deliver complex and critical support to infrastructure, equipment and training programmes. Babcock operates in many sectors, including transport, energy, defence, telecommunications and education.

 

We take great pride in the considerable depth and breadth of our people's expertise. Our 26,000 skilled staff design, build, manage, operate and maintain assets that are vital to the delivery of many key public services, both in the UK and overseas.
